Relative subgroup growth and subgroup distortion

open access: yesGroups, Geometry, and Dynamics, 2015
We study the relative growth of finitely generated subgroups in finitely generated groups, and the corresponding distortion function of the embeddings. We explore which functions are equivalent to the relative growth functions and distortion functions of finitely generated subgroups. We also study the connections between these two asymptotic invariants

Relative growth and condition factor of the Finescale Triggerfish in the southeastern Gulf of California

open access: yesCalifornia Fish and Wildlife Journal
Relative growth and body condition of the Finescale Triggerfish (Balistes polylepis) were evaluated using fishery-dependent data from the southeastern Gulf of California across eight sampling periods between 2002 and 2024.
